Transaction 1591feef34e706025726338210af9776381ef8bf85c8116871c5a3f1636821d6
1 Input
1 Output
-
1591feef34e706025726338210af9776381ef8bf85c8116871c5a3f1636821d6:0
- value
- 5045
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d2caa9bbb30e61da01624733553452c8b392d5125cf430135db8a43fbd262c8f
- address
- bc1p6t92nwanpesa5qtzgue42dzjezee94gjtn6rqy6ahzjrl0fx9j8sfu0320